Formed in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been dedicated to reducing the time to market for innovators creating new medical devices. The company distinguishes itself by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times typically between 1 to 3 days—an achievement infeasible with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ard identified the crucial need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for active development programs innovating inn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is paramount in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old substantial value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Alongside rout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Reasons Medical Device Sterilization is Essential

Protection from infections remains a mainstay of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Adequate sterilization of medical devices considerably re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ers equally. Ineffective sterilization can give rise to outbreaks of severe di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Steam Sterilization (Autoclaving)

Autoclaving remains the most frequent and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is quick, budget-friendly, and green,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Sophisticated Materials and Device Complexity

The surge of state-of-the-art med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ization methods capable of handling sensitive materials. Advancements in sterilization include methods for example low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ging fine components.
